#Keepsafe ways to support your community
Self-isolating postcards have been given out to people in local areas, containing information such as the person’s name, what area they live in, phone number and an option of what they need help with. You could also:
- Check on elderly or vulnerable neighbours
- Pick up shopping or medication for the elderly, vulnerable & self-isolating
- Organise a virtual meet up with local friends & neighbours
- Posting mail
- A friendly phone call
- Chat through a window to provide a much needed voice
- Urgent delivery of supplies
- Join a closed Facebook community page
- Set up a neighbours WhatApp page to keep in touch
Become a Corona Friend
Corona friend project has been launched to help people offer support to their neighbours and ensure nobody is left feeling isolated and lonely.


There are three easy steps:
- Check the map on the website to see if your area has already been covered
- Download the leaflet
- Drop the leaflet through your neighbours doors
